Output 60cb6cf3629355ec427daa51306b7538b30850a30a03ed414c4029ae16ba220c:0

value
8692871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70d7b048115b23dbee8f023f0d525483a8accd1 OP_EQUAL
address
3MJ7MRygQBRAdFfhEuKHzvsanvqHSeB9WN
transaction
60cb6cf3629355ec427daa51306b7538b30850a30a03ed414c4029ae16ba220c
confirmations
186487
spent
true